This installment of "30 for 30" seems a lot like many others at the start. However, this story about the San Francisco Bay World Series turns out to be about far more than just sports when one of the games is halted due to a huge earthquake--one that flattened major portions of the city. What follows is very atypical for the shows, as in addition to interviews with various athletes, the program interviews a lot of non-players--folks who were affected by the earthquake and who didn't even attend the game. All this has a great way of putting everything into perspective, as several athletes pointed out that baseball is only a game and the quake was THE story. Some of the stories are sad and compelling--so you might want to have some Kleenex handy just in case. Very well made and worth seeing.
